In this essay, W. E. B. Du Bois raises questions such as:

  • What is the real meaning of race?
  • What has, in the past, been the law of race development?

He describes the American Negro Academy, which aimed to be the epitome and expression of the intellect of African Americans. He concludes by outlining a proposed creed for the Academy.
